Designing the Perfect Team ChallengesThe secret to a successful karaoke weekend lies in variety, ensuring that both seasoned stage veterans and self-proclaimed shower singers feel included. Instead of standard individual performances, structured group challenges foster collaboration and strategic thinking. One highly effective format is the Decade Decathlon, where teams draw a random era, such as the 1970s or the early 2000s, and must assemble a medley that captures the definitive sound of that generation. Another popular concept is the Genre Swap, which requires a pop group to deliver a country song, or a rock enthusiast to tackle a classic hip-hop track, forcing performers to step outside their comfort zones with hilarious and impressive results.

Incorporating Strategy and SabotageTo keep the energy high across a full weekend, organizing committees can introduce strategic gameplay elements. Mystery Box challenges involve teams choosing sealed envelopes containing a song title they must perform completely blind, without prior practice. For groups that thrive on playful rivalry, a lighthearted sabotage mechanic can be introduced. Teams earn points in early rounds that can be spent to impose handicaps on their opponents. These handicaps might include singing while wearing giant oven mitts, incorporating mandatory choreographic moves like the robot, or performing a serious ballad while wearing ridiculous costume props. This shifts the focus away from pure vocal talent and places the emphasis squarely on entertainment value and resilience.

The Technical and Logistic SetupExecuting a seamless musical weekend requires a bit of logistical preparation, though it does not necessitate professional-grade equipment. Modern portable karaoke machines with wireless microphones and Bluetooth connectivity can easily turn any living room into a main stage. Utilizing dedicated streaming applications or curated video playlists ensures an endless library of tracks across all genres. To ensure fairness and maintain momentum, it helps to establish a clear scoring rubric beforehand. Audiences can judge performances based on three simple categories: vocal effort, stage presence, and crowd engagement. Utilizing digital voting links or physical scorecards keeps everyone actively involved, even when they are not holding the microphone.
